      In the intense competition of the Latvian Higher League, a thrilling encounter is set to take place. This season, Odariga has had a solid performance, sitting in third place with 39 points from 12 wins, 3 draws, and 5 losses, boasting a 60.0% win - rate. At home, they've played 9 games, with 5 wins, 1 draw, and 3 losses. They've scored 20 goals and conceded 12, with a goal difference of +8. On the other hand, Riga FC is having an outstanding campaign, leading the pack with 49 points from 15 wins, 4 draws, and 1 loss, achieving a remarkable 75.0% win - rate. In away games, they've played 10 matches, winning 7, drawing 2, and losing only 1. They've scored 31 goals and conceded just 10, with a goal difference of +21, clearly demonstrating their strong dominance on the road. Looking at their recent form, Riga FC has been in excellent shape, winning 5 and drawing 1 in their last six games.     • Panevėžys adheres to a pragmatic counter - attacking strategy, which is highly targeted and well - adapted to the playing rhythm of possession - based opponents. The team proactively contracts its defense to avoid vulnerabilities, with an average of 10.8 interceptions per game. Their low - position defensive system is solid, capable of effectively neutralizing delicate passing and controlling attacks. In the midfield, they abandon ineffective ball - holding and focus on accelerating the transition between offense and defense. The counter - attack starts quickly, and the finishing in the front - court is steady. However, the team lacks offensive initiative. They mostly rely on opponents' mistakes to find opportunities and have relatively limited ability to initiate continuous offensive campaigns on their own.     • Brazil continues to adopt a 4-3-3 high-pressing formation, relying on a combination of delicate individual skills and team passing and ball control to dominate the game. Their overall competitive stability is at an extremely high level. The team has an average passing success rate of 83% and usually maintains about a 70% possession rate in matches. The midfield passing rhythm is tight, with an average passing time of only 2.2 seconds, indicating high offensive efficiency. The front line shows smooth cooperation between wing breakthroughs and central penetrations. They have a 45% success rate in counter - tackles, enabling them to quickly regain possession and launch attacks. However, there are still some minor flaws in their defense. Their attention sometimes slackens, and there are slight gaps in the wing defensive coverages.     • The Netherlands adheres to the 4-3-3 tactical concept, focusing on high-position ball control and three-dimensional offensive advancement. Their overall passing and control framework is well - developed and regular. In normal matches, the team's passing success rate can reach 87%, and the average ball possession rate is close to 60%. They rely on frequent forward runs on the flanks and penetration in the middle to stretch the opponent's defense, with an average of about 14 shots per game. However, the team has obvious weaknesses. The defenders are relatively slow in turning back to chase, and there is a lack of full - time defensive players in the midfield, resulting in insufficient interception intensity. When facing high - intensity midfield pressing, the team is prone to making mistakes when passing the ball from the backcourt.
